Coronation Street boss Kate Brooks has revealed major spoilers for 2026, including a flashforward episode that will show a dead body on the street, with five potential victims. The special episode, airing in mid-February, jumps months ahead and sets up a whodunnit storyline that will unfold over spring and early summer.
Brooks told The Mirror: 'During the course of our flash forward episode, we discover that one of our characters has found a dead body on the street, and we don't know who it is. There are five potential victims and we'll take the audience on a journey for them to try and figure out who that body is, what happened, what's the backstory to it.'
The storyline will involve many character groups and feature numerous twists. Brooks added: 'Just when we think that the story's going in one direction, we absolutely do a U-turn and go into a completely different direction. It'll keep people guessing until the very end.'
Meanwhile, Todd's abusive relationship with Theo continues. After Billy's death at Theo's hands, Theo manipulates Todd further, exploiting his guilt and vulnerability. Brooks explained: 'Theo hones in on the fact that Todd is still quite vulnerable... He does everything he can to try be an absolute pillar of support... but we know what Theo's capable of.'
Brooks also teased a possible wedding for fan favourites Swarla, hinting at happier moments amid the dark storylines. The soap is set for an eventful 2026 with these interconnected plots.
